The pH of KNO2 in Water - phscale.org 6 Jun 2024 · The pH of a potassium nitrite (KNO2) solution is basic or alkaline, meaning it has a pH greater than 7. This is due to KNO2 being a salt of a strong base (KOH) and a weak acid (HNO2). When KNO2 dissolves in water, it breaks down into its ions, and the nitrite ion (NO2-) reacts with water to form hydroxide ions (OH-), raising the pH above 7.
Potassium nitrite - Oxford Reference 3 Apr 2025 · A white or slightly yellow deliquescent solid, KNO 2, soluble in water and insoluble in ethanol; r.d. 1.91; m.p. 440°C; may explode at 600°C. Potassium nitrite is prepared by the reduction of potassium nitrate.

Potassium nitrite - Wikipedia Potassium nitrite (distinct from potassium nitrate) is the inorganic compound with the chemical formula K N O 2. It is an ionic salt of potassium ions K + and nitrite ions NO 2−, which forms a white or slightly yellow, hygroscopic crystalline powder that is soluble in water. [1]
